Themeda caudata
What's the taxonomical classification of Themeda caudata?
Themeda caudata belongs to the kingdom Plantae and is classified under the phylum Streptophyta. Within this group, it is categorized under the class Equisetopsida and the subclass Magnoliidae. Its taxonomic progression continues through the order Poales and into the family Poaceae. Finally, the plant is placed within the genus Themeda, specifically identified as the species caudata.
